The new register does not have the facility to order overprinted referral forms.
A six month supply should have been ordered via the old register. A new process for overprinting will be communicated to Regional Services early in the New Year.

The NCSP Register User Guide is a resource for users of the NCSP Register — it is a detailed, technical document. The document is available in electronic form only, on the National Screening Unit website. The document can be downloaded as sections. The Register User Guide was last updated in January 2012.
